51Testing软件测试论坛

标题: ftp_get_ex() 如何传递变量参数进去 [打印本页]

作者: walkingsky    时间: 2008-7-22 12:05
标题: ftp_get_ex() 如何传递变量参数进去
int ftp_get_ex (FTP *ppftp, char *transaction, char *item_list, LAST);

想动态的下载到不同的目录里面,想通过变量来实现
char * temp;
sprintf(temp,"TARGET_PATH=d:/",dir);
ftp_get_ex(&pFTP,"",
"SOURCE_PATH=/ftp/server/dir/file",
temp,
"MODE=BINARY",
ENDITEM,
LAST
)

不成功, 请问如何实现???

谢谢!
作者: walkingsky    时间: 2008-7-22 17:53
自己 up 一下。

目前只能用 if 判断变量的方法,根据不同的值,调用不同的写死了参数的ftp_get_ex() 函数。 很麻烦!
作者: 云层    时间: 2008-7-22 21:17
用lr_save_string()写参数的方法试试




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2